Subject: Handover — Pondwright pooler release

Hi team,

Handing over the Pondwright connection pooler rollout. Pool sizes were retuned for the Ostrava replica set; watch for saturation alerts during the Tuesday batch window. Rollback steps are in the runbook, section four. For verifying the staged artifacts, the deploy key you'll need is as follows.

deploy key for kajof-fajop: bky6_gDHw9Q

## Step 4: Migrate the spooler

Retire the legacy Brindlecote print daemon and deploy the new Quenfold spooler microservice. Note for review: the new service binds only to the internal mesh and drops root after startup. Verify the hardened defaults before go-live. The service ships with the following configuration:

config for tagep-yajef:
ulawyn:
  log_level: error
  metrics_host: metrics.ulawyn.lumiclabs.internal
  pin: 0564
  pool_size: 32

Step 4: Replace the homegrown queue. Rip out the old Taskwheel dispatcher from the worker pods and point everything at Quenby, our managed queue. Do not run both in parallel past one deploy cycle; duplicate job IDs will collide. Drain Taskwheel first (see Step 3), then flip the feature flag in Crestline staging before prod. Verify the dead-letter path with a forced failure. Apply the following configuration values to each worker node before restarting.

config for bahop-fajep:
DRUATH_PIN=4501
DRUATH_TENANT=briwyn
DRUATH_METRICS_HOST=metrics.druath.brasksoft.test
DRUATH_SEAL=seal_7d2e069d
DRUATH_STANDBY_TEAM=olieth